Modern Family Garden, Hale, Cheshire by Barnes Walker Ltd, Manchester

The full garden design undertaken by Barnes Walker included a new front garden, driveway and entrance as well as an extensive rear garden makeover.

The client had three main wishes for the rear garden; a play space for their two kids, an outdoor cooking / seating area and that the whole garden could be used to entertain large groups of friends and family.

The symmetrical architecture of the house is such that we could use it divide the garden into two distinct zones –kids (play space) and an adult (entertaining space). We then used the cooking and formal seating area (family space) along with a commonality of materials, tree species and architectural features to link the two.

The play space takes up the larger proportion of garden and consists of a large area of astro turf and a bespoke double height play house, with storage for toys and bean bags underneath, a climbing wall, a fireman’s pole and WiFi connection!

The adult zone, consists of a large south facing raised patio surrounded by L-shape metal posts with wire trellis supporting flowering climbers and a sculptural hand-beaten copper seat which moves slowing in the wind, hanging on the edge acting as focal point from anywhere within the garden.

Four pairs of roof-top parasol trees march away from the house and additional L shape posts and climbers frame the outdoor kitchen and formal seating area which is centred on the house and primary doors out with a water feature providing the back stop to the vista.

Thin metal fins and planting act as a divide whilst allowing the two zones to feel visually connected- ensuring the kids are still well within sight of parents.

The high-tech garden also has a full surround sound speaker system installed and discrete lighting.
